The Latin America region has a vision to transform lives in dynamic communities. As an intern, you'll serve in your area of focus while being part of localized summer ministry experiences. You'll also be poured into by a team of missionaries as you learn more about your gifts and passions. Our hope for the internship experience is that you will grow in your relationship with God, expand your skill set, be more prepared to disciple people from other cultures, and perhaps discern a long-term call to missions and ministry.
You will serve with Satura, Mexico, an organization that specializes in church planting ministry in Mexico. They train and equip churches to multiply by evangelizing to find persons of peace and start new worshipping groups

You will serve with Satura, Mexico, an organization that specializes in church planting ministry in Mexico. They train and equip churches to multiply by evangelizing to find persons of peace and start new worshipping groups
Responsibilities
- Work alongside our Satura kids and youth teams to help facilitate and train individuals to reach their communities for Christ.
- Serve to facilitate formal training sessions, vacation Bible schools, youth camps, and Bible clubs.
- High School Diploma or GED required
- Some college preferred
- Basic Spanish needed
- Adaptability
- Good relational skills
- Desire to see Gospel transformation
- You will be interning from early-June to early-August.
- You will live in Mexico City at the seminary guest house apartments or a missionary home.
- Cost will be $3,000 plus travel expenses.
- This is a volunteer internship that requires raising financial support through ministry partners.
